Important Message from Mr. Norton, LTISD Superintendent
LTISD Offering Temporary Online Learning Option
August 6, 2021
Dear Lake Travis ISD Parents and Guardians,
Taking into consideration Austin Public Health (APH) has elevated its COVID-19 Risk-based Guidelines to Stage 5 and after carefully reviewing your feedback in our recent ThoughtExchange, we have several important updates to share with you.
We recognize that you have many questions about the coming year. To help support your planning and your child’s return to school, we have posted our covid protocols titled “Safe Return to In-Person Instruction and Continuity of Instruction Plan” on our website.
Secondly, we will offer a temporary online learning option this fall for students in kindergarten through 6th grade only. Program criteria include but are not limited to:
Only currently eligible LTISD students can apply
Students will maintain enrollment in their home campus
Students must commit to attending the entire fall semester. Students will not be able to return to their home campus until January, 2022, at the earliest.
Students will require parent supervision and support during virtual school hours
Instruction will be delivered in both synchronous (teacher-led) and asynchronous (independent) learning formats
Extracurricular activities or other on-campus activities will not be available to virtual students
6th grade electives are limited to art and PE; students will not have access to on campus programs such as band, athletics, theater, etc.
The first 250 student applications received will be allowed into the virtual option; all requests will be time-stamped in the order received
The forms must be submitted per student, not per family
The program will be reevaluated and extended as necessary but we are only committing to the Fall, 2021, semester at this time.
Students who are accepted into the online learning option will begin classes on Monday, August 23. All other students are expected to report to their campus for in-person learning on Wednesday, August 18 as scheduled. If your student is attending school in person, no action is needed at this time.
Between 5:00 pm, Saturday, August 7 and noon, Wednesday, August 11, families who are interested in having their K-6 grade student attend classes online will have an opportunity to submit an application for enrollment. The application will be available in Skyward Family Access.
For more information about our online learning option opportunity, as well as answers to Frequently Asked Questions and instructions on how to enroll your child, visit our Response to COVID-19 webpage. Please note, this page and supporting resources will continue to be updated as new information becomes available.
Lastly, as a reminder, Governor Greg Abbott’s executive order prohibits school districts from requiring anyone to wear a mask or other face covering. In alignment with the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, the American Academy of Pediatrics, and the Austin-Travis County Health Authority, APH strongly recommends that all individuals in schools mask when indoors (regardless of vaccination status) and outdoors, when in crowded settings or during activities that involve sustained close contact with others. While we recognize and respect personal choice, we also strongly encourage all staff, students and families to wear a mask while inside and on campus.
On behalf of our school board and administration, we look forward to welcoming you and your family to a safe and successful school year. We thank you for your continued patience and understanding as we work through these times together.
